Police arrest 10 teenagers over killing of Chattogram boy

Detectives have arrested 10 teenagers from different places around Halishahar of the port city for their alleged involvement in the killing of teenage boy Mohammad Sumon.

A team of Detective Branch of Chittagong Metropolitan Police (CMP) arrested them, aged 16-18, in a drive on Tuesday night, said CMP Deputy Commissioner (DB) Mohammad Shahidullah who led the drive.

A knife used for killing Sumon and his mobile phone were also recovered from their possession, he said, adding that all of them had been involved in crimes like snatching and eve-teasing.

Sumon, 17, along with his two friends fell prey to muggers while returning home after enjoying a movie at BDR Cinema Hall in Halishahar area on Sunday night.

In their bid to take away Sumon's mobile phone, the hoodlums stabbed the teenager indiscriminately, leaving him critically injured.

He was taken to Chittagong Medical College Hospital where the duty doctor declared him dead around 3:00am on Monday, reports UNB.
